I can deal with Lost Levels and Super Meat Boy just fine. I'm okay at platforming, i guess. But this game...

SMB3 just loves to throw at least five enemies at the same time and it just breaks me. Earlier this night i played underwater level and at one time there were two small green fishes, one big red fish, two jellyfishes each one with four small jellyfishbabies -- all coming to get me. Oh and the level autoscrolled too. It was more closer to horizontal shmup on twitch difficulty than Mario game.

I appreciate how it originated so many things for the series and how imaginative every single level is. But i am not really having fun. Even the controls feel weird to me -- it's like i'm on ice at all times and all jumps feel too high (sounds stupid i know, but that's how i feel).

Also half of the things in game just don't make sense to me, level design wise. Like why some levels end with a black screen and others have additional hills? Lots of levels have areas that are just there. There is nothing in it. Some levels i blast through within 20 seconds and some are too hard for me.

Maybe i'm doing something wrong. Maybe it's DS Lite (i'm playing GBA version) and i should play it on a big screen.

Some levels i couldn't even understand where am i supposed to go. I went everywhere and i can't find an exit. Previous levels where i had that i just skipped, but now it's a castle (on world 7) and i have to beat it somehow to advance through the map.

Yoshi's Island had similar levels with keys and doors, but there it was laid out more clear. Here i just don't get it.
